Copolymers of ethylene with butene‐1 and long chain α‐olefins. I. Decene‐1 as long chain α‐olefin

The possibility was studied of using decene‐1 as comonomer with ethylene in a slurry type polymerization with Ziegler–Natta catalysts. Under the reaction conditions used decene contents remained at the 2 wt% level in ethylene/decene‐1 copolymers. When additionally butene‐1 was present in the polymerization, decene‐1 contents were significantly higher. A synergistic effect was identified in the reactivities of butene‐1 and decene‐1 in terpolymerization with ethylene. The comonomer reactions were determined and comonomer contents measured by 13 C‐NMR spectroscopy. Decene‐1 content had an effect on the polymer density and crystallinity, but virtually no effect on melting temperature. With high comonomer contents an additional melting range was identified in DSC curves at about 100°C.
